
Afghanistan Under-19 secured a 28-run victory over South Africa Under-19 in their opening match of the ICC U19 World Cup 2026 at Windhoek. Afghanistan posted 266 for 8, with key contributions from Khalid Ahmadzai (74), Faisal Shinozada (81), and Uzairullah Niazai (51*). South Africa, led by Jason Rowles' 98, were bowled out for 238. Both teams enter the tournament with contrasting recent performances, with Afghanistan aiming to improve after early exits in 2024 and South Africa seeking their first U19 title in over a decade.
